Life is Strange Articles

Upcoming RPGs of 2015: Day Three
Nothing's going to stop this train of game coverage.
feature by Zack Reese on 29 January, 2015

Square Enix's new Adventure Game may be worth a look for RPG fans
Life is Strange, developed by French studio Dontnod, seems Square's most interesting project in years.
preview by Alex Donaldson on 29 August, 2014